// Copyright (c) 2005 DMTF. All rights reserved.// <change cr="ArchCR00066.004" type="add">Add UmlPackagePath// qualifier values to CIM Schema.</change>// ==================================================================// CIM_PolicyActionStructure// ================================================================== [Association, UMLPackagePath ( "CIM::Policy" ), Abstract, Aggregation, Version ( "2.6.0" ), Description ( "PolicyActions may be aggregated into rules and into compound " "actions. PolicyActionStructure is the abstract aggregation " "class for the structuring of policy actions.")]class CIM_PolicyActionStructure : CIM_PolicyComponent { [Aggregate, Override ( "GroupComponent" ), Description ( "PolicyAction instances may be aggregated into either " "PolicyRule instances or CompoundPolicyAction instances.")] CIM_Policy REF GroupComponent; [Override ( "PartComponent" ), Description ( "A PolicyAction aggregated by a PolicyRule or " "CompoundPolicyAction.")] CIM_PolicyAction REF PartComponent; [Description ( "ActionOrder is an unsigned integer 'n' that indicates the " "relative position of a PolicyAction in the sequence of " "actions associated with a PolicyRule or " "CompoundPolicyAction. When 'n' is a positive integer, it " "indicates a place in the sequence of actions to be " "performed, with smaller integers indicating earlier " "positions in the sequence. The special value '0' indicates " "'don't care'. If two or more PolicyActions have the same " "non-zero sequence number, they may be performed in any " "order, but they must all be performed at the appropriate " "place in the overall action sequence. \n" "\n" "A series of examples will make ordering of PolicyActions " "clearer: \n" "o If all actions have the same sequence number, regardless " "of whether it is '0' or non-zero, any order is acceptable. " "\no The values: \n" "1:ACTION A \n" "2:ACTION B \n" "1:ACTION C \n" "3:ACTION D \n" "indicate two acceptable orders: A,C,B,D or C,A,B,D, \n" "since A and C can be performed in either order, but only at " "the '1' position. \n" "o The values: \n" "0:ACTION A \n" "2:ACTION B \n" "3:ACTION C \n" "3:ACTION D \n" "require that B,C, and D occur either as B,C,D or as B,D,C. " "Action A may appear at any point relative to B, C, and D. " "Thus the complete set of acceptable orders is: A,B,C,D; " "B,A,C,D; B,C,A,D; B,C,D,A; A,B,D,C; B,A,D,C; B,D,A,C; " "B,D,C,A. \n" "\n" "Note that the non-zero sequence numbers need not start with " "'1', and they need not be consecutive. All that matters is " "their relative magnitude.")] uint16 ActionOrder;};
